Reading Rock Stars

About the Program

The Texas Book Festival’s Reading Rock Stars program is a hands-on literacy initiative that sends nationally recognized authors into Title I elementary schools in Texas to inspire young readers with dynamic presentations and send them home with the most empowering experience of all – owning their very own book. The Texas Book Festival funds and coordinates the author visits and donates the books to the children as well as a set of books to each school’s library.

The program currently serves schools in Austin, the Rio Grande Valley, Houston, Dallas, Fort Worth, and El Paso with a strategic plan to grow the number of schools served in each geographic area. Impact

Since the inception of the program, the Texas Book Festival has donated more than 166,000 books to students in Title I schools and provided 757 author visits.

Authors and Illustrators

Collage RRS Historical authors

Previous Reading Rock Stars authors include: Erin Entrada Kelly, Kwame Alexander, Ibi Zoboi, Christian Robinson, Raina Telgemeier, Monica Brown, Michaela Goade, Don Tate, Mac Barnett, Dan Santat, Christina Soontornvat, Vanessa Brantley-Newton, Raúl the Third, Derrick Barnes, and Elisa Chavarri.
